Welfare economist Jean Dreze awarded for his research on poverty and inequality measurement in India

New Delhi, Jun 14 (UNI) Renowned Belgian-born Indian welfare economist Jean Dreze was awarded the Global Inequality Research Award (GiRA) during the world inequality conference organised at the Paris School of Economics.
Dreze got this recognition due to his pioneering work on poverty and inequality measurement in India and his advocacy for the National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(NREGA) and the National Food Security Act (NFSA).
After receiving this award, Dreze said, " This recognition is not something I achieved on my own. All the work I do is in collaboration with people and collectives working for change."
"I live and work in India, which was rightly described as a 'museum of inequality' by Dr BR Ambedkar. India has all possible varieties of inequality—not only astronomical economic inequality, but also the caste system, huge gender disparities, massive disparities in access to education, and so forth. The silver lining is that India also has a rich history of resistance to inequality. I've been very fortunate to be associated with some of these movements," Dreze said.
Academically, economist Dreze has a PHD in theoretical economics of cost-benefit analysis from the Indian Statistical Institute. He also studied mathematical economics at the University of Essex in the 1980s.
He contributed rigorously to critical areas of development economics, such as hunger, famine, education, gender inequality, childcare, school feeding, and employment guarantee.
The GiRA is a prestigious international prize recognising scholars whose work has improved the understanding of economic, social and environmental inequalities.
